The Psychological Approach to Dream Meaning
Sigmund Freud, the father of psychoanalysis, was one of the first to delve deeply into the psychological aspect of dreams. He theorized that dreams are a manifestation of our repressed desires and unconscious thoughts. According to Freud, every dream holds a deeper meaning, which can be deciphered by analyzing its content. Modern psychologists continue to explore these themes, seeing dreams as a window into emotional and mental states. They argue that interpreting dreams can help individuals confront unresolved issues or emotions.

The Cultural Influence on Dream Interpretation
Cultural beliefs and practices play a significant role in how dreams are interpreted. Various societies have different views on the significance of dreams, and these beliefs often shape how people perceive their own dreams. For example, ancient Egyptians viewed dreams as messages from the gods, while indigenous cultures believed that dreams were a way to communicate with the spirit world. In many cultures, specific dream symbols have established meanings, often related to life cycles, spiritual journeys, or societal values.
